CLAYTON, Mo., May 06, 2026 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- Perimeter Solutions, Inc. $(PRM)$ ("Perimeter," "Perimeter Solutions," or the "Company"), a leading provider of industrial products and services that support critical and complex customer missions across a range of niche applications, today reported financial results for its first quarter ended March 31, 2026.

First Quarter 2026 Results

   -- Net sales increased 74% to $125.1 million in the first quarter, as 
      compared to $72.0 million in the prior year quarter. 
 
          -- Fire Safety net sales increased 22% to $45.5 million, as compared 
             to $37.1 million in the prior year quarter. 
 
          -- Specialty Products net sales increased 128% to $79.6 million, as 
             compared to $34.9 million in the prior year quarter. 
 
   -- Net income during the first quarter was $72.9 million, or $0.44 earnings 
      per diluted share, as compared to net income of $56.7 million, or $0.36 
      earnings per diluted share in the prior year quarter. 
 
   -- First quarter non-GAAP adjusted earnings per diluted share was $0.06, as 
      compared to non-GAAP adjusted earnings per diluted share of $0.03 in the 
      prior year quarter. 
 
   -- Adjusted EBITDA increased 128% to $41.2 million in the first quarter, as 
      compared to $18.1 million in the prior year quarter. 
 
          -- Fire Safety Segment Adjusted EBITDA increased 85% to $18.7 million, 
             as compared to $10.1 million in the prior year quarter. 
 
          -- Specialty Products Segment Adjusted EBITDA increased 181% to $22.5 
             million, as compared to $8.0 million in the prior year quarter.

Capital Allocation

   -- On January 22, 2026, the Company acquired the outstanding capital stock 
      of Medical Manufacturing Technologies, LLC ("MMT") for a total cash 
      purchase price, net of cash acquired of $682.3 million which was funded 
      with cash on hand and proceeds from a senior secured notes offering. MMT 
      is included within the Specialty Products segment. 
 
   -- The Company invested $5.8 million in capital expenditures during the 
      quarter ended March 31, 2026.

About Perimeter Solutions

Perimeter Solutions (NYSE: PRM) is a leading provider of industrial products and services that support critical and complex customer missions across a range of niche applications. Perimeter's focus on superior customer service, paired with our Value Driver-focused operating strategy, decentralized operating model, and focus on driving value via capital allocation and capital structure management, fulfills our dual mandate: to serve customers and create value for stockholders. Perimeter is comprised of two segments, Fire Safety, including fire retardants and fire suppressants, and Specialty Products, which currently spans lubricant additives, electronic and electro-mechanical components, and highly engineered machinery for the medical device industry. Adjusted EBITDA and Segment Adjusted EBITDA

Adjusted EBITDA and Segment Adjusted EBITDA are defined as income (loss) before income taxes plus net interest and other financing expenses, and depreciation and amortization, adjusted on a consistent basis for certain non-recurring, unusual or non-operational items. These items include (i) restructuring, (ii) acquisition related costs, (iii) founder advisory fee expenses, (iv) stock-based compensation expense, (v) purchase accounting impact and (vi) foreign currency loss (gain). Adjusted Net Income and Adjusted Earnings Per Share

The computation of Adjusted Earnings Per Share ("Adjusted EPS") is defined as Adjusted Net Income divided by adjusted diluted shares. Adjusted Net Income is defined as net income (loss) plus amortization, certain non-recurring, unusual or non-operational items, and the tax impact of these non-GAAP adjustments. These adjustments include (i) restructuring, (ii) acquisition related costs, (iii) founder advisory fee expenses, (iv) stock-based compensation expense, (v) purchase accounting impact and (vi) foreign currency loss (gain). Adjusted diluted shares is the weighted average diluted shares outstanding, adjusted by adding dilution for options excluded under U.S. GAAP due to a net loss, less dilution related to founders advisory fees.
